DTN Closing Livestock Comment 08/14 15:52
   Weakness Follows Livestock Contracts Through Friday's Close

   Only a handful of cash cattle sales have been reported in the South, but
cattle were mostly being marked at $228, which is $7.00 lower than last week's
weighted average.

ShayLe Stewart
DTN Livestock Analyst

GENERAL COMMENTS:

   The livestock complex ended Friday softer as fundamental support was hard to
come by this week. A few live cattle sales were noted at $228, which is $7.00
lower than last week's weighted average. December corn is up 11 1/4 cents per
bushel and December soybean meal is up $2.30. The Dow Jones Industrial Average
is down 107.58 points and NASDAQ is down 73.87 points.
